Django的小玩意儿是一个Django应用程序允许模板包含标签的配置打靶。
安装:
#。加入** **小玩意儿给你**安装的应用程序**设置。
#。 ROOT_GIZMOCONF值添加到您的项目设置文件::
    ROOT_GIZMOCONF ='project.gizmos“
#。在表单创建您的小玩意配置文件::
   小玩意=(
&NBSP;&NBSP;&NBSP;&NBSP;&NBSP;&NBSP;&NBSP; (“<装载机名>”,“<标签名>”,“<插槽名称>”,〔'
&NBSP;&NBSP;&NBSP; )
用:
* <装载机名>是你通常会传递给Django的负载标记的名称,即** ** myapp_inclusion_tags为** {%负载myapp_icnlusion_tags%} **。
* <变量名称>是要包含标记的名称,即** **广告**为{%广告%} **
* <插槽名称>是你想要的标签中显示的插槽的名称,即** **家。
*
用法:
小玩意儿是股票的标准的Django包含标签。唯一diffirence是不是指定的标签模板内所指定从远处的标签通过与小物件标签一起使用小物件CONF文件。
例如,假设我们有一个** **广告**中的myapp **的包含标签,我们只是想叫&NBSP指定的标签;在名为**广告小玩意儿插槽**名为网址** **家:
#。创建您的标记为正常。
#。在表单创建您的小玩意配置文件::
&NBSP;&NBSP;&NBSP;小玩意=(
&NBSP;&NBSP;&NBSP;&NBSP;&NBSP;&NBSP;&NBSP; (“myapp_inclusion_tag','广告','广告',['家',]),
&NBSP;&NBSP;&NBSP; )
#。在模板的主视图加载小玩意儿包含标签,其中包括与广告的插槽名称的小玩意标签::
&NBSP;&NBSP;&NBSP; {%负载gizmo_inclusion_tags%}
&NBSP;&NBSP;&NBSP; ......一些HTML ...
&NBSP;&NBSP;&NBSP; {%小玩意'home_advert“%}
&NBSP;&NBSP;&NBSP; ......一些HTML ...
什么在此版本中是新的:
- 在带包装达到标准
要求:
- 在Python中
- 在Django的
评论没有发现